The "Diamond Sutra," also known as Chin-Kang-Ching or Prajna-Paramita-Unknown, is a foundational text in Mahayana Buddhism that explores profound themes of emptiness, perception, and the nature of reality. This ancient scripture invites listeners to reflect on the impermanence of all things and the importance of compassion in the pursuit of enlightenment. Its teachings resonate deeply in today's fast-paced world, encouraging mindfulness and a deeper understanding of one's self and others. The wisdom contained within the "Diamond Sutra" remains timeless, offering guidance for navigating the complexities of life and fostering a sense of inner peace and clarity.
